Q: Is 6,727,801 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 6,727,801 is a composite number.

Why is 6,727,801 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 6,727,801 can be evenly divided by 1 17 373 1,061 6,341 18,037 395,753 and 6,727,801, with no remainder.

Since 6,727,801 cannot be divided by just 1 and 6,727,801, it is a composite number.
